YOUNG v YOUNG [2021] NZHC 369

YOUNG v YOUNG [2021] NZHC 369

Ella Young, as the successful party, was entitled to costs against Jina Kim. Costs in the Property Law Act proceeding were assessed on the 2B scale with specific disallowances and arithmetic corrections, resulting in $40,027.00; costs for the Family Court phase were awarded at the claimed legal aid repayment of $5,516.00. Costs-on-costs claims were denied and the respondent's impecuniosity did not justify any abatement. Total award $45,543.00.

Procedural Posture

Costs Application Following Determination of Property Law Act 2007 and Property (relationships) Act 1976 Proceedings / Post Judgment Costs Assessment

  1. 1 Whether successful party entitled to costs against unsuccessful party in both proceedings
  2. 2 Appropriate scale and quantum of costs (2B assessment)
  3. 3 Whether impecuniosity of respondent justifies reduction or abatement of costs

Ratio Decidendi

Ella Young, as the successful party, was entitled to costs against Jina Kim. Costs in the Property Law Act proceeding were assessed on the 2B scale with specific disallowances and arithmetic corrections, resulting in $40,027.00; costs for the Family Court phase were awarded at the claimed legal aid repayment of $5,516.00. Costs-on-costs claims were denied and the respondent's impecuniosity did not justify any abatement. Total award $45,543.00.

Court Disposition

Costs awarded to Ella Victoria Young against Jina Kim in the sum of $45,543.00

Orders

  • Order awarding costs of $40,027.00 to Ella Victoria Young in respect of the Property Law Act proceeding
  • Order awarding costs of $5,516.00 to Ella Victoria Young in respect of the Property (Relationships) Act/Family Court phase
